本文将深度探索呼玛ios软件的流程,并分享资深技术人员的经验。文章分为五个大段落,分别从需求分析、工具选择、代码实现、测试与调试、上线发布五个环节进行了详尽的讲解。通过本文的阅读,相信读者能够对ios软件开发的流程有更深刻的了解和掌握。
1. 需求分析
在开发ios软件之前,首要的任务就是进行需求分析。需求分析是开发者理解客户需求表达的过程,也是规划项目的重要步骤。在这个阶段我们需要了解客户的需求和设想,获得项目的初步范围以及目标用户。因此,在这个阶段我们可以通过与客户的沟通、分析竞品和市场、制定用户画像等方式进行需求分析。需求分析完成后,我们就可以对项目的设计和开发有个更明确的方向。
2. 工具选择
在完成需求分析后,我们需要通过选择合适的工具来进行开发。对于ios开发,Xcode是必不可少的工具。在接下来的开发过程中,我们还需要用到各种第三方的库和框架以及一些常用的工具如Git、CocoaPods等。因此,在选择工具的时候需要仔细评估并选择与项目需求和团队技能匹配的工具。
3. 代码实现
在选择好工具之后,我们就需要开始进行代码实现了。ios应用通常是基于MVC(Model-View-Controller)架构进行设计和实现的,因此我们需要根据需求分析,将构建模型、视图以及控制器。在实现代码时需要注重代码质量和可扩展性,避免重复而且难以维护的代码结构。同时需要注重代码的注释和文档的编写,方便其他的开发者可以理解和使用你的代码。
4. 测试与调试
应用程序开发过程中,测试和调试是非常重要的环节,也是确保应用程序质量的关键。我们需要进行单元测试、集成测试甚至是UI测试,保证应用程序的稳定性和可靠性。在测试过程中,我们还需要找出并修复在应用程序中出现的问题和漏洞。
5. 上线发布
应用程序经过测试和调试后,就可以进行上线发布了。在上线发布的过程中,我们需要将应用程序提交到App Store中进行审核。在提交审核之前,我们需要认真检查应用程序是否符合相关的规范和要求。通过审核后我们需要进行营销和推广,吸引更多的用户下载并使用我们的应用程序。
本文从需求分析、工具选择、代码实现、测试与调试、上线发布五个环节进行了详尽的讲解。相信通过本文的阅读,读者可以对ios软件开发的流程进行更深入的了解。作为一名开发者,我深刻认识到,开发一个优秀的应用不仅需要专业技术,还需要良好的团队合作,积极的思维和创新精神。希望本文可以为有志于从事ios应用开发的读者提供一些有用的参考和指导。
本文主要介绍了资深技术人员如何深度探索呼玛ios软件的开发流程,分为五个主要部分:前期准备、UI设计、功能开发、测试和上线。在这五个部分中,我们将着重介绍如何规划开发流程、如何设计UI界面、如何实现核心功能、如何进行测试以及如何将应用上线等方面,以帮助读者更好地了解呼玛ios软件的开发流程,并提供一些实用的经验和技巧。
1.前期准备
在进行呼玛ios软件开发之前,我们需要进行一系列的前期准备工作,包括需求分析、功能规划、技术选型、人员配备等方面。首先,我们需要了解呼玛ios软件的基本需求,包括用户群体、使用场景、功能需求等方面。然后,根据需求分析的结果,我们需要制定开发计划和进度表,并确定开发团队的人员配备和工作分配。
在技术选型方面,我们需要选择合适的开发工具和技术框架,并明确开发人员在技术方面的要求和能力。在人员配备方面,我们需要合理规划开发团队的人员构成和分工,确保团队成员的技术能力和经验能够满足项目需求。
2.UI设计
UI设计是呼玛ios软件开发过程中非常重要的一环,良好的UI设计能够增强用户体验,提高应用的使用价值。在UI设计方面,我们需要根据呼玛ios软件的使用场景和用户需求,设计清晰、简洁、美观的界面。首先,我们需要制定UI设计原则和风格,明确UI界面的色彩、布局、字体等方面的设计要求。
在具体的UI界面设计中,我们需要使用专业的设计工具(例如Sketch、Adobe XD、Figma等),根据界面布局和元素设计规范,设计出完整、美观、简洁的UI界面。在设计过程中,我们需要考虑用户交互体验、界面响应速度等方面的问题,确保UI界面能够完美地服务于用户需求。
3.功能开发
功能开发是呼玛ios软件开发过程中最为核心的一部分。在功能开发方面,我们需要按照开发计划和进度表,分阶段、有序地完成各项功能开发工作。在功能开发之前,我们需要进行系统架构设计和数据模型设计等工作,明确应用的整体框架和数据流程。
在具体的功能开发过程中,我们需要从易到难、分阶段进行开发,确保每个阶段都能够顺利完成。同时,我们需要注重代码的质量和可维护性,使用优秀的开发框架和工具,保证代码的规范、稳定、高效。在开发过程中,我们需要及时修复漏洞和问题,确保应用的安全和稳定性。
4.测试
测试是呼玛ios软件开发过程中非常重要的一环。在测试方面,我们需要进行功能测试、性能测试、兼容性测试等多方面测试,确保应用的质量和稳定性。在测试之前,我们需要编写详细的测试计划和测试用例,明确测试内容和测试要求。
在具体的测试过程中,我们需要使用专业的测试工具,并按照测试计划和测试用例执行测试。在测试过程中,我们需要注重问题的反馈和修复,及时修复测试中发现的问题,保证应用的质量和稳定性。
5.上线
上线是呼玛ios软件开发过程中最为关键的一步。在上线之前,我们需要进行一系列的准备工作,包括应用提交、审核流程、推广计划等方面的准备。在应用提交和审核流程中,我们需要仔细阅读相关的审核规则和要求,保证应用能够顺利通过审核流程。
在推广方面,我们需要制定合适的推广计划,包括应用宣传、用户引流、社交媒体营销等几个方面。在主推平台的选择方面,我们可以选择Apple Store、应用宝、360手机助手、小米应用商店等多个平台进行主推。
总之,呼玛ios软件开发过程需要经过前期准备、UI设计、功能开发、测试和上线等多个环节。在每个环节中,我们需要注重细节和质量,保证应用能够完美地服务于用户需求。同时,我们还需要持续学习和更新技术,不断提升自己的技术能力和开发经验。这样才能更好地探索呼玛ios软件的开发流程,创造出更好的应用产品。